Airport; Izmir Adnan Menderes
The 3rd largest city of Turkey. The metropolis of the Aegean region, which was after Istanbul the most visited cosmopolitan city of the XIX century (Chateaubriand, Maximilian of Austria, Lord Byron, Lamartine). Lamartine wished to exploit a farm in the vicinity (Tire) which belonged to Baltazzi Family. (See note page nr:12)
Izmir, with its beautiful bay (amazing view from Alexander's Castle), sea front promenade, cafes and fair grounds offers within its vicinity the most prestigious archaeological sites as Ephesus, Sardis, Pergamum and the 7 Churches of the Revelation. Smyrne est une princesse
Avec son beau chapel, L' heureux printemps sans cesse
Repond a son appel Et, comme un riant groupe
De fleurs dans une coupe Dans ses mers se découpe
Plus d ' un frais archipel.
Victor Hugo |

Airport; Bodrum
The most "in" summer resort for the Turkish "jet" set. Alive with night-clubs, bars and cafes, an exquisite marina, plus the Castle of the Knights of St. John. Bodrum offers many hotels and holidays villages with meeting facilities. |
